    Quote Originally Posted by Seb283 View Post
    Hi guys,

    I started this game just today and opted for my favourite country, Switzerland, hoping to be able to annex later some close regions like aosta or baden... Problem is that after 2 years of industrialisation, and without being agressive in any way, Piedmont declares war, followed by France. No way to resist, I have to accept losing eastern Switzerland.

    Is that a normal behaviour of the game, Piedmont attacks Switzerland so early?
    Check your relations with them. If they're negative, they get a higher chance of getting a random "Acquire State CB" against you. So try to constantly increase relations and ally a GP to keep yourself safe. Sadly there's no such thing as Swiss Neutrality in vanilla.

    Quote Originally Posted by Swiftwind View Post
    How do you make a province you own a core province?

    Playing as Dai Nam (I managed to civilize it), I took Brunei a long time ago, and its a state province with the majority culture as Vietnamese, but Its not considered a core province. Yet other places around me (British and Dutch) managed to get their acquisitions as core provinces.
    Ahh, a fellow Dai Nam player! Anyway, whether it's a state or colony, there's an event that can fire once you've discovered a tech (I think Nationalism & Imperialism, it's in that chain) that gives you a core. It's random, so no guarantees how long it will take.

    Quote Originally Posted by ArschGranate View Post
    Vanilla 1.3

    Some inventions give "Permanent Prestige +1%" - what exactly does that mean? I can't seem to find it anywhere in the prestige tool-tip, nor in the country modifiers in the Diplomatic overview?

    Edit: Upon further inspection it is not "Permanent Prestige +1%", but "Permanent Prestige +1". Still, what's the permancy about?
    "Permanent Prestige +1" simply gives you +1 prestige. "Permanent Prestige +1%" is a modifier applied to all positive prestige gains after that, be it from events/techs or military action.

    How does one tag switch without having to save, resign, load as the other country, meddle, save, resign, load back up as yourself?

    The way it's talked about on here implies there's a cheat code for it, and as much as I avoid cheating in general, I'm not averse to a little bit of meddling.

    just open the console by pressing ~, the button above left tab, then type tag XXX, where XXX is the country tag that you want to switch to.
